Ashton Stamps Files Transfer Paperwork While Long Declares For NFL Draft
Sun Devil's biggest returning starters leave Tempe with little star power
The Devil's Due Mailbag — Offseason Transfer Portal Coverage Image By Diego Alfaro
Owen Long and Ashton Stamps, along with Lyrick Rawls and Emar'rion Winston, were the heart and soul of the maligned Sun Devils defense in 2026.

Now, all four will be gone. Rawls and Winston both exhausted their eligibility after their senior seasons, while Stamps will enter the transfer portal as he looks to finish his final year of eligibility and Long—a projected fifth round pick—opted to cash in on his stock now after a stellar first season in Tempe.

"We wish them the best," said a measured Charlie Weis Jr. to the media, "Obviously, they are talented players. We'd love to have them back. But we only want guys who want to be here and be a part of what we're building."

"Unfortunately, they didn't see the vision, so now they'll have to watch us shine from afar."

While Stamps and Long departed, longtime Sun Devil CJ Fite once again stayed put, signaling he was going to end his collegiate career in Tempe.

"I can't leave after all we've been through ASU!" he posted on IG with a picture of him and ASU mascot Sparky.

In all, the Sun Devils will be losing 21 total players from last year's squad. Joining Long in declaring for the draft was redshirt junior Reed Harris, while several Sun Devils from the bottom of the roster also filed their paperwork.

Arizona State Heavily Recruiting Austin Mack As Portal Opens
UCLA, Cal also recruiting former Huskies recruit
The Devil's Due Mailbag — Offseason Transfer Portal Coverage Image By Diego Alfaro
Austin Mack entered the 2026 season expecting to compete with Keelon Russell for the Crimson Tide's quarterback job, having spent the previous two seasons behind Jalen Milroe and Ty Simpson after following Kalen DeBoer from Washington.

Russell ultimately won the job for the campaign, winning the Shaun Alexander Award as the best freshman in the country. Then, Kalen DeBoer was fired by the Crimson Tide after a 5-7 season.

Both played a role in Mack finally entering the transfer portal ahead of his final year of eligibility.

"I don't have any regrets over how it panned out, but at some point, you gotta do what's best for you," said Austin Mack about entering the portal.

The former four-star recruit did not appear in any games with the Crimson Tide last season, but contributed 250 yards and three touchdowns in spot duty during the 2025 campaign.

Mack stands at 6'6" and 230 pounds. Despite his lack of playing time, one source is still very high on Mack's measurables.

"He still has the plus arm; that hasn't gone anywhere," began the scout, "He can get it to all three levels of the field without a problem. His accuracy is more than adequate in the short and intermediate routes, but his deep ball really shines. If it wasn't for Russell's athleticism, Mack would have won the job. And for what it's worth, the Crimson Tide's passing attack would have stretched a few more teams vertically with Mack's arm strength as opposed to Russell's athleticism."

Mack is scheduled to visit Tempe in a few days' time and is expected to take visits to Los Angeles for UCLA as well as Berkeley for the Golden Bears.
